Nikolay Dimitrov is a Bulgarian footballer currently playing as a midfielder for the Turkish Süper Lig side Kasımpaşa. He was born on 15 October 1987 in Ruse, Bulgaria.
The product of Levski Sofia youth system Nikolay embarked on his professional career at the parent club in 2004. He made a total of 18 goals in 89 matches during a six-year stint at the club. Together with his team Nikolay won the Bulgarian Cup in 2007 and three Bulgarian Supercups in 2005, 2007 and 2009.
On 15 May 2010, Dimitrov signed a contract with Turkish Kasımpaşa. The footballer made his debut for the club in a match against Gaziantepspor on 14 August 2010. The first goal was scored on 20 November 2010 in a game against Gençlerbirliği.
Nikolay Dimitrov is capped to the Bulgaria national team since 2008. On 6 February 2008 he made his international debut in a friendly match against Northern Ireland that took place in Belfast.
